## PR: Smooth queue-depth autoscaler response

This change replaces the Fennwick autoscaler's instantaneous queue-depth trigger with a rolling average, which stops the flapping we saw during the Ostermont backfill. Scale-down now requires two consecutive quiet windows. On-call impact: fewer pages, slightly slower scale-up under sudden bursts. The constants controlling window size and thresholds are set as follows.

tuning constants:
QUOTAS = {
    "druwyn": 5,
    "holix": 5,
    "zorath": 5,
    "holwyn": 10,
}

## Releases

ShelfStream publishes catalogue-import builds monthly. Plugin authors must target the import schema pinned in each release tag; MARC-variant mappings change between minors, so re-run the Stackwise conformance suite before publishing. Unsigned plugin bundles are rejected by the registry. All official ShelfStream artifacts are signed; verify downloads before building against them using the key below.

release key, yafof-kadup: bky4_soBk

Quick rundown: we're proposing a modest bump to the training budget — about 9% over this year — mostly driven by the Opaline platform rollout and the certification push in the Calder Bay office. Vendor-led courses stay flat; the increase goes to internal academies, which have been cheaper per head anyway. Travel for training drops again, as most sessions moved virtual. Nothing scary in the numbers, honestly. One confidential note on broader business plans is attached just below.

internal memo for yahaf-hawif: The finance team signed off on a budget of $59.9 million for Project Rusax.

- [ ] Step 7: Archive cold storage buckets (Glacierline tier). Confirm both ceremony witnesses are present, verify bucket manifests match the Oxbow ledger, then seal the archive key shares. Plugin authors may observe but not handle shares. Once sealed, the archive index itself is encrypted and can only be reopened with the passphrase below.

vault phrase of badup-hahig = tamael-aldael-kelmir-istael-fenok-istwyn-tamius-jorath-oliion